What Is the Cost of Living Near Beaumont?

Understanding the cost of living near Beaumont is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Texas State Hearing Aid Specialists Inc.
Beaumont's Cost of Living Index is approximately 80.7 (19.3% less expensive than US average; 13.2% less than TX average). SE TX city, petrochemicals, affordable. BMT. When planning your budget based on a salary from Texas State Hearing Aid Specialists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$750 - $1,100+ A significant portion of Texas State Hearing Aid Specialists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ation Limited local transit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$360 - $540 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$300 - $580+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$640+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,950 - $3,120+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
